Output 57a6752d70b3b1bb306a6123ab042a17881484aee362b6ce8d4750a16a2e625a:1

value
599853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 453d6957671e20138424795a4528fa1ecdf92801 OP_EQUAL
address
38187j1kGMHzs7BMPEpNyW7FpjovZqMjbH
transaction
57a6752d70b3b1bb306a6123ab042a17881484aee362b6ce8d4750a16a2e625a
spent
true